Nettet7. feb. 2024 · It has been recommended that Lecithin be used to prevent plugged ducts. To treat recurrent plugged ducts, take 3600-4800 mg lecithin every day or one capsule (1200 milligrams every 3-4 hours). A mother can reduce her dosage by one capsule after two or more weeks if her medication does not obstruct. Nettet2. aug. 2024 · Mastitis means inflammation of the breast - and inflammation can narrow ducts causing a slow-down in flow - often called a “plug”. Usually this can be relieved with some extra attention - gentle …
